Zusammenfassung:The utility model provides a hydro-generator air gap magnetic flux monitoring device, which comprises a stator and a rotor, and is characterized in that a plurality of circles of linear magnetic flux sensors are wound on a stator iron core from an inner circle to an outer circle at intervals, and each circle of linear magnetic flux sensor is fixed on the stator iron core through a plurality of fixing blocks; each circle of linear magnetic flux sensor is led out to be connected with a connecting line, and the connecting line is electrically connected with an external measuring element or a measuring terminal.
